Dreamy Digital Canvas Shadowbox
Lately, I have been wanting to decorate my house. One of my projects is in our master bedroom. In here I would love to create a photo gallery celebrating US. I am thinking of a mixture of Canvas, frames, Quotes, shadow boxes with pieces from our wedding i.e. wedding favors. I started off with this
Heidi Swapp Wooden Shadow box Frame digi Canvas project. I first painted it with white acrylic paint let it dry. In photoshop I used Heidi Swapp's digital phrase that I had onto one of my favorite photo that was taken in Hawaii by Red Heart Photography and added more digital elements from Heidi Swapp's digi shop. Hearts and word phrases are from Instaframes Colorfuls and just randomly placed it above us. You can see my tutorial post on how to add word art here. Once all that is done I printed it onto Sticky back Canvas by Ranger. I then adhered these amazing ephemera from her new collection Dreamy. You won't believe how packed full this little package has! I just love every piece! Oh and that cute glittery gold star you see? It's from her Glittery Gold Stickers that's available at Michaels. I also added that "xoxo" from Amy Tan's new line Plus One collection. Very simple and yet beautiful piece to my photo gallery of US.
